英文摘要
The overall objective of this study is to characterize the components of
the cell surface of the sea urchin egg and to elucidate the role of these
components in the initial events in fertilization. 1) We will continue
studies on the components of a cell surface complex isolated from eggs that
consists of the plasma membrane, coated on the outer side with peripheral
proteins of the vitelline layer and on the inner side with cortical
vesicles. Following further subfractionation the vitelline components,
plasma membrane, cortical vesicle membrane, and the contents of the
cortical vesicles will be isolated, and analyzed comparatively for
polypeptides, lipids, and marker enzymes. To obtain a clearer picture of
the fate of these components following fertilization, they will be compared
with known components of the hyaline layer and the fertilization envelope.
2) The ion permeability of vesicles prepared from the plasma membrane, the
cortical vesicle membrane and a mosaic membrane consisting of both of them
will be measured to determine if one of these membranes is responsible for
the enhanced influx of Ca++ and Na+ into the egg observed upon
fertilization. 3) We will investigate the possibility that Ca++ dependent
breakdown and arachidonic acid release. The cell surface complex may be an
excellent model to study the kinetic and functional relationships between
secretion and arachidonic acid production and metabolism. 4) The structure
of the sulfated polysaccharides in egg jelly coat will be studied to define
the structural differences that result in species specific induction of the
acrosomal reaction in sperm. Using jelly coat as an affinity ligand we
will undertake the isolation of the protein on the surface of the sperm
that functions as a receptor of jelly coat. The properties and mode of
action of the isolated receptor in inducing the acrosomal reaction will be
studied. 5) Using binding, or antibody prepared towards a glycopeptide
fragment of the receptor as tools, we will isolate the receptor for sperm
from solubilized egg cell surface membranes. The purified receptor will be
characterized and the structural components of it responsible for both
sperm adhesion and species specificity will be defined.
